Join to apply for the Golang Engineer - Remote Work | REF#87515  role at BairesDev  
 2 weeks ago Be among the first 25 applicants 
 At BairesDev, we've been leading the way in technology projects for over 15 years.
We deliver cutting-edge solutions to giants like Google and the most innovative startups in Silicon Valley.
 Our diverse 4,000+ team, composed of the world's Top 1% of tech talent, works remotely on roles that drive significant impact worldwide.
 When you apply for this position, you're taking the first step in a process that goes beyond the ordinary.
We aim to align your passions and skills with our vacancies, setting you on a path to exceptional career development and success.
 Golang Engineer at BairesDev 
 Being a Golang Engineer in our Development Team is like being a full-time problem solver.
We expect your abilities to be a combination of experience, knowledge, and independence.
Innovation is at the heart of BairesDev strategy.
If you're willing to take on complex tasks and master your tech stack, especially Golang, you are probably one of the candidates we're seeking.
These developers face numerous technical challenges, utilizing current technologies across mobile, web applications, devices, and more.
 What You Will Do 
  - Scope and design applications.
 
 
- Collaborate with the business team to gather requirements.
 
 
- Build applications in Golang.
 
 
- Develop custom APIs. 
- Develop the front end (language TBD and can influence).
 
 
- Coordinate with Infrastructure team to set up environments in Coinbase (AWS, EC2, Docker).
 
 
- Implement testing with Circle CI.
 
 
Here Is What We Are Looking For 
  - Experience with SQL and NoSQL databases.
 
 
- Experience with Microservices and Cloud platforms.
 
 
- Advanced knowledge of algorithms.
 
 
- IT infrastructure knowledge.
 
 
- Intermediate understanding of agile methodologies.
 
 
- Strong grasp of best practices, SOLID principles, CLEAN Code, and scalable solutions.
 
 
- Knowledge of Design Patterns.
 
 
- Experience developing complete applications from scratch.
 
 
- Experience with automated testing, CI/CD pipelines.
 
 
- Proficiency with Version control systems.
 
 
- Experience with Unit testing, integration testing, and ensuring code coverage.
 
 
- Advanced English proficiency.
 
 
How We Make Your Work (and Your Life) Easier 
  - 100% remote work from anywhere.
 
 
- Competitive compensation in USD or your local currency.
 
 
- Hardware and software setup provided for remote work.
 
 
- Flexible hours to create your own schedule.
 
 
- Paid parental leave, vacations, and holidays.
 
 
- Multicultural environment with top global talent.
 
 
- Supportive environment with mentorship, growth, and skill development opportunities.
 
 
Join a global team where your talents can truly thrive! 
 #J-18808-Ljbffr